Transaction 400c29f3a7507aad3c1abd7c15cf1bf950dde6e41b20bc2680245a8c2f33228b

27 Input
1 Outputs
  • 400c29f3a7507aad3c1abd7c15cf1bf950dde6e41b20bc2680245a8c2f33228b:0
  • value  51703415
    address  1MESQUrEEyv1JBXf7mH78KJZc381Zes9eN